Product Development Lab Technician
Joulé · Irvine, CA · 1 wk ago
Analyst$32–$35/hrContract
Responsibilities
- Conduct experiments and perform a variety of technical procedures in the development of materials for electronics applications.
- Work on special PD development projects as guided by supervisors.
- Strong laboratory and research skills: compliance with all safety regulations, sound lab technique and good record keeping.
- Gather and analyze data using Albert digital system and provide fast communications to supervisors.
Requirements
- Ability to work in a fast-paced environment in a team or on their own and perform assignments with limited supervision.
- Hands-on and enjoys working with machines and tools, and coming up with new ideas.
- Previous experience in a laboratory environment is preferred.
- Strong problem-solving skills and well organized.
- Excellent verbal and written communication.
- Strong computer skills: MS office.
- Self-Starter; collaborative team player with an entrepreneurial spirit and can-do attitude.
- Project management skills: strong work ethic and ability to meet work deadlines.
Qualifications
- Degree in Chemistry, Chemical Engineering, Material Sciences and Engineering; Polymer Materials.
